Maryland is one of the pricier states in the country - a Bureau of Economic Analysis regional price index of 105.0 against the 100 national average, about 5% higher overall - which is exactly what the starting home price below is adjusted for, instead of a flat national default.
Maryland taxes income at graduated rates up to about 5.75%, plus county-level tax this estimate doesn't include.
That makes it the 8th most expensive state in the country by this measure, out of 51 - worth knowing before assuming a national-average mortgage payment applies here.
